다음을 통해 공유


StorageTasks interface

StorageTasks를 나타내는 인터페이스입니다.

메서드

beginCreate(string, string, StorageTask, StorageTasksCreateOptionalParams)

지정된 매개 변수를 사용하여 새 스토리지 작업 리소스를 비동기적으로 만듭니다. 스토리지 작업이 이미 만들어지고 후속 만들기 요청이 다른 속성으로 발급된 경우 스토리지 작업 속성이 업데이트됩니다. 스토리지 작업이 이미 만들어지고 후속 만들기 또는 업데이트 요청이 정확히 동일한 속성 집합으로 발급되면 요청이 성공합니다.

beginCreateAndWait(string, string, StorageTask, StorageTasksCreateOptionalParams)

지정된 매개 변수를 사용하여 새 스토리지 작업 리소스를 비동기적으로 만듭니다. 스토리지 작업이 이미 만들어지고 후속 만들기 요청이 다른 속성으로 발급된 경우 스토리지 작업 속성이 업데이트됩니다. 스토리지 작업이 이미 만들어지고 후속 만들기 또는 업데이트 요청이 정확히 동일한 속성 집합으로 발급되면 요청이 성공합니다.

beginDelete(string, string, StorageTasksDeleteOptionalParams)

스토리지 작업 리소스를 삭제합니다.

beginDeleteAndWait(string, string, StorageTasksDeleteOptionalParams)

스토리지 작업 리소스를 삭제합니다.

beginUpdate(string, string, StorageTaskUpdateParameters, StorageTasksUpdateOptionalParams)

스토리지 작업 속성 업데이트

beginUpdateAndWait(string, string, StorageTaskUpdateParameters, StorageTasksUpdateOptionalParams)

스토리지 작업 속성 업데이트

get(string, string, StorageTasksGetOptionalParams)

스토리지 작업 속성 가져오기

listByResourceGroup(string, StorageTasksListByResourceGroupOptionalParams)

지정된 리소스 그룹에서 사용할 수 있는 모든 스토리지 작업을 Lists.

listBySubscription(StorageTasksListBySubscriptionOptionalParams)

구독에서 사용할 수 있는 모든 스토리지 작업을 Lists.

previewActions(string, StorageTaskPreviewAction, StorageTasksPreviewActionsOptionalParams)

입력 개체 메타데이터 속성에 대해 입력 조건을 실행하고 응답에서 일치하는 개체를 지정합니다.

메서드 세부 정보

beginCreate(string, string, StorageTask, StorageTasksCreateOptionalParams)

지정된 매개 변수를 사용하여 새 스토리지 작업 리소스를 비동기적으로 만듭니다. 스토리지 작업이 이미 만들어지고 후속 만들기 요청이 다른 속성으로 발급된 경우 스토리지 작업 속성이 업데이트됩니다. 스토리지 작업이 이미 만들어지고 후속 만들기 또는 업데이트 요청이 정확히 동일한 속성 집합으로 발급되면 요청이 성공합니다.

function beginCreate(resourceGroupName: string, storageTaskName: string, parameters: StorageTask, options?: StorageTasksCreateOptionalParams): Promise<SimplePollerLike<OperationState<StorageTask>, StorageTask>>

매개 변수

resourceGroupName

string

리소스 그룹의 이름. 이름은 대소문자를 구분하지 않습니다.

storageTaskName

string

지정된 리소스 그룹 내의 스토리지 작업의 이름입니다. 스토리지 작업 이름은 길이가 3자에서 18자 사이여야 하며 숫자와 소문자만 사용해야 합니다.

parameters
StorageTask

스토리지 작업을 만들 매개 변수입니다.

options
StorageTasksCreateOptionalParams

옵션 매개 변수입니다.

반환

Promise<@azure/core-lro.SimplePollerLike<OperationState<StorageTask>, StorageTask>>

beginCreateAndWait(string, string, StorageTask, StorageTasksCreateOptionalParams)

지정된 매개 변수를 사용하여 새 스토리지 작업 리소스를 비동기적으로 만듭니다. 스토리지 작업이 이미 만들어지고 후속 만들기 요청이 다른 속성으로 발급된 경우 스토리지 작업 속성이 업데이트됩니다. 스토리지 작업이 이미 만들어지고 후속 만들기 또는 업데이트 요청이 정확히 동일한 속성 집합으로 발급되면 요청이 성공합니다.

function beginCreateAndWait(resourceGroupName: string, storageTaskName: string, parameters: StorageTask, options?: StorageTasksCreateOptionalParams): Promise<StorageTask>

매개 변수

resourceGroupName

string

리소스 그룹의 이름. 이름은 대소문자를 구분하지 않습니다.

storageTaskName

string

지정된 리소스 그룹 내의 스토리지 작업의 이름입니다. 스토리지 작업 이름은 길이가 3자에서 18자 사이여야 하며 숫자와 소문자만 사용해야 합니다.

parameters
StorageTask

스토리지 작업을 만들 매개 변수입니다.

options
StorageTasksCreateOptionalParams

옵션 매개 변수입니다.

반환

Promise<StorageTask>

beginDelete(string, string, StorageTasksDeleteOptionalParams)

스토리지 작업 리소스를 삭제합니다.

function beginDelete(resourceGroupName: string, storageTaskName: string, options?: StorageTasksDeleteOptionalParams): Promise<SimplePollerLike<OperationState<StorageTasksDeleteHeaders>, StorageTasksDeleteHeaders>>

매개 변수

resourceGroupName

string

리소스 그룹의 이름. 이름은 대소문자를 구분하지 않습니다.

storageTaskName

string

지정된 리소스 그룹 내의 스토리지 작업의 이름입니다. 스토리지 작업 이름은 길이가 3자에서 18자 사이여야 하며 숫자와 소문자만 사용해야 합니다.

options
StorageTasksDeleteOptionalParams

옵션 매개 변수입니다.

반환

Promise<@azure/core-lro.SimplePollerLike<OperationState<StorageTasksDeleteHeaders>, StorageTasksDeleteHeaders>>

beginDeleteAndWait(string, string, StorageTasksDeleteOptionalParams)

스토리지 작업 리소스를 삭제합니다.

function beginDeleteAndWait(resourceGroupName: string, storageTaskName: string, options?: StorageTasksDeleteOptionalParams): Promise<StorageTasksDeleteHeaders>

매개 변수

resourceGroupName

string

리소스 그룹의 이름. 이름은 대소문자를 구분하지 않습니다.

storageTaskName

string

지정된 리소스 그룹 내의 스토리지 작업의 이름입니다. 스토리지 작업 이름은 길이가 3자에서 18자 사이여야 하며 숫자와 소문자만 사용해야 합니다.

options
StorageTasksDeleteOptionalParams

옵션 매개 변수입니다.

반환

beginUpdate(string, string, StorageTaskUpdateParameters, StorageTasksUpdateOptionalParams)

스토리지 작업 속성 업데이트

function beginUpdate(resourceGroupName: string, storageTaskName: string, parameters: StorageTaskUpdateParameters, options?: StorageTasksUpdateOptionalParams): Promise<SimplePollerLike<OperationState<StorageTask>, StorageTask>>

매개 변수

resourceGroupName

string

리소스 그룹의 이름. 이름은 대소문자를 구분하지 않습니다.

storageTaskName

string

지정된 리소스 그룹 내의 스토리지 작업의 이름입니다. 스토리지 작업 이름은 길이가 3자에서 18자 사이여야 하며 숫자와 소문자만 사용해야 합니다.

parameters
StorageTaskUpdateParameters

스토리지 작업 리소스를 업데이트하기 위해 제공할 매개 변수입니다.

options
StorageTasksUpdateOptionalParams

옵션 매개 변수입니다.

반환

Promise<@azure/core-lro.SimplePollerLike<OperationState<StorageTask>, StorageTask>>

beginUpdateAndWait(string, string, StorageTaskUpdateParameters, StorageTasksUpdateOptionalParams)

스토리지 작업 속성 업데이트

function beginUpdateAndWait(resourceGroupName: string, storageTaskName: string, parameters: StorageTaskUpdateParameters, options?: StorageTasksUpdateOptionalParams): Promise<StorageTask>

매개 변수

resourceGroupName

string

리소스 그룹의 이름. 이름은 대소문자를 구분하지 않습니다.

storageTaskName

string

지정된 리소스 그룹 내의 스토리지 작업의 이름입니다. 스토리지 작업 이름은 길이가 3자에서 18자 사이여야 하며 숫자와 소문자만 사용해야 합니다.

parameters
StorageTaskUpdateParameters

스토리지 작업 리소스를 업데이트하기 위해 제공할 매개 변수입니다.

options
StorageTasksUpdateOptionalParams

옵션 매개 변수입니다.

반환

Promise<StorageTask>

get(string, string, StorageTasksGetOptionalParams)

스토리지 작업 속성 가져오기

function get(resourceGroupName: string, storageTaskName: string, options?: StorageTasksGetOptionalParams): Promise<StorageTask>

매개 변수

resourceGroupName

string

리소스 그룹의 이름. 이름은 대소문자를 구분하지 않습니다.

storageTaskName

string

지정된 리소스 그룹 내의 스토리지 작업의 이름입니다. 스토리지 작업 이름은 길이가 3자에서 18자 사이여야 하며 숫자와 소문자만 사용해야 합니다.

options
StorageTasksGetOptionalParams

옵션 매개 변수입니다.

반환

Promise<StorageTask>

listByResourceGroup(string, StorageTasksListByResourceGroupOptionalParams)

지정된 리소스 그룹에서 사용할 수 있는 모든 스토리지 작업을 Lists.

function listByResourceGroup(resourceGroupName: string, options?: StorageTasksListByResourceGroupOptionalParams): PagedAsyncIterableIterator<StorageTask, StorageTask[], PageSettings>

매개 변수

resourceGroupName

string

리소스 그룹의 이름. 이름은 대소문자를 구분하지 않습니다.

options
StorageTasksListByResourceGroupOptionalParams

옵션 매개 변수입니다.

반환

listBySubscription(StorageTasksListBySubscriptionOptionalParams)

구독에서 사용할 수 있는 모든 스토리지 작업을 Lists.

function listBySubscription(options?: StorageTasksListBySubscriptionOptionalParams): PagedAsyncIterableIterator<StorageTask, StorageTask[], PageSettings>

매개 변수

options
StorageTasksListBySubscriptionOptionalParams

옵션 매개 변수입니다.

반환

previewActions(string, StorageTaskPreviewAction, StorageTasksPreviewActionsOptionalParams)

입력 개체 메타데이터 속성에 대해 입력 조건을 실행하고 응답에서 일치하는 개체를 지정합니다.

function previewActions(location: string, parameters: StorageTaskPreviewAction, options?: StorageTasksPreviewActionsOptionalParams): Promise<StorageTaskPreviewAction>

매개 변수

location

string

작업의 미리 보기를 수행할 위치입니다.

parameters
StorageTaskPreviewAction

작업 조건을 미리 볼 매개 변수입니다.

options
StorageTasksPreviewActionsOptionalParams

옵션 매개 변수입니다.

반환